What is a Paper Ream?
A paper ream is a standard unit of measurement for paper, usually including 500 sheets. The term "ream" has its origins in the Arabic word "rizmah," implying a bundle or package. Reams are important in the paper market as they offer a constant method to plan and offer sheets of paper.

Different areas and industries might use varying paper sizes. For instance, North America mostly uses the U.S. basic paper sizes, while the majority of other countries abide by the ISO (International Organization for Standardization) standards. Below is a relative table of typical paper sizes.

Another essential aspect of any paper ream is its weight, typically represented in pounds (lbs) or grams per square meter (gsm). The weight determines the thickness, toughness, and general quality of the paper. A helpful list of common paper weights is as follows:

When acquiring paper reams, different factors should be considered to guarantee the best choice for your requirements:
Purpose: Identify the desired use of the paper. Will it be for printing, crafting, or expert presentations?
Weight and Thickness: Choose a weight that fits your requirements, bearing in mind that thicker paper tends to yield higher quality outcomes.
Complete: Decide in between matte, gloss, or satin finishes depending on your wanted outcome, specifically for photographic or promotional materials.
Ecological Factors: Consider recycled alternatives or paper that has sustainable sourcing certifications, which can decrease ecological impact.
Compatibility: Ensure that the paper works with your printer type (inkjet, laser, and so on) to prevent jams or bad quality prints.
